在VirtualBox上安裝OS X 10.10

nomasp發表於2015-06-02

下面將介紹的嚮導用於介紹怎樣通過免費而強大的VirtualBox在虛擬機器上安裝OS X Yosemite 10.10

這裡寫圖片描述

法律免責宣告:本指南旨在說明如何在定期購買的蘋果電腦上建立一個虛擬機器執行真正的Mac OS X作業系統,僅用於測試目的。

怎樣做

1 在App Store下載Yosemite

2 開啟 Terminal.app

3 安裝iesd,若要自定義OS X InstallESD:

gem install iesd

4 開始安裝映象到基本系統

iesd -i "/Applications/Install OS X Yosemite.app" -o yosemite.dmg -t BaseSystem

5 轉換為稀疏影象格式

hdiutil convert yosemite.dmg -format UDSP -o yosemite.sparseimage

6 裝入InstallESD

hdiutil mount "/Applications/Install OS X Yosemite.app/Contents/SharedSupport/InstallESD.dmg"

7 以及稀疏圖影象

hdiutil mount yosemite.sparseimage

8 複製基本系統到稀疏影象

cp "/Volumes/OS X Install ESD/BaseSystem."* "/Volumes/OS X Base System/"

9 彈出InstallESD

hdiutil unmount "/Volumes/OS X Install ESD/"

10 以及稀疏影象

hdiutil unmount "/Volumes/OS X Base System/"

11 解除安裝這兩個安裝的磁碟

via diskutil: 
diskutil unmountDisk $(diskutil list | grep "OS X Base System" -B 4 | head -1)
diskutil unmountDisk $(diskutil list | grep "OS X Install ESD" -B 4 | head -1)

如果不奏效,並且在第12步返回“資源忙”,請嘗試使用Disk Utility:

這裡寫圖片描述

12 轉換會UDZO格式(壓縮影象)

hdiutil convert yosemite.sparseimage -format UDZO -o yosemitefixed.dmg

13 將yosemitefixed.dmg作為光碟機載入到Virtual Box中

14 更改你的虛擬機器的晶片組為“PIIX3”

15 啟動您的VM、用內安裝程式開啟Disk Utility,並且在虛擬磁碟上建立一個新的分割槽 HFS+

16 安裝了!

問答

錯誤訊息:“核心驅動程式未安裝(rc=-1908)”

請嘗試重新安裝VirtualBox來修復此錯誤

引匯出現問題:“缺少藍芽控制器”

請嘗試以下步驟來解決此問題:

1 停止在VirtualBox中的虛擬機器
2 開啟一個新的終端視窗
3 執行一下命令,以調整使用者CPU

VBoxManage modifyvm '<YourVMname>' --cpuidset 1 000206a7 02100800 1fbae3bf bfebfbff



感謝您的訪問,希望對您有所幫助。 歡迎大家關注、收藏以及評論。


為使本文得到斧正和提問,轉載請註明出處:
http://blog.csdn.net/nomasp


相關文章